Q: Is 21,577,664 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 21,577,664 is not a prime number.

Why is 21,577,664 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 21577664 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 32 64 233 466 932 1,447 1,864 2,894 3,728 5,788 7,456 11,576 14,912 23,152 46,304 92,608 337,151 674,302 1,348,604 2,697,208 5,394,416 10,788,832 and 21,577,664, with no remainder.

Since 21,577,664 cannot be divided by just 1 and 21,577,664, it is not a prime number.
